Intense Rainfall Leads to Significant River Overflow in West Java
Recent severe weather events have resulted in substantial flooding across parts of West Java, Indonesia. On May 4th, the Cipamingkis river experienced a major overflow due to sustained, heavy rainfall across the region. The deluge has severely impacted local infrastructure and residential areas, necessitating rapid community response.
Eyewitness accounts confirm the destructive power of the surging waters. The torrent caused demonstrable damage to private establishments, including a glamping site that was compromised by the floodwaters. Furthermore, the scale of the inundation presented an immediate threat to community structures, with reports indicating that an educational facility was nearly damaged by the rising water.
Understanding the Human and Material Impact
The immediate aftermath of the flooding has affected a significant number of residents, with reports suggesting that over 150 families have been directly impacted by the rising waters. Despite the considerable disruption to daily life and the damage sustained by local properties, official preliminary reports indicate that there were no recorded instances of injuries or fatalities associated with the flood event. The focus remains on assisting the affected households and assessing the total extent of the material damages across the community.
